Anime Duelists Gems and Game Passes
Spend premium currency on permanent upgrades, not potions you burn in one session.
Gems are the premium currency in Anime Duelists on Roblox. You earn them from achievements, quests, Battle Pass tiers, and especially promo codes on the Codes page. You spend them primarily on Game Passes — permanent account upgrades — inside the Shop menu. Because Gems are slow to grind free, every purchase should compound across all future worlds instead of vanishing after one luck session.
This guide ranks what to buy first, explains why Multi Open, Extra Equip, and Fast Open dominate the Game Passes tier list, and shows how Gem income ties into Mythical and Secret Units hunting.

Free Gem income before you spend
Maximize zero-cost Gems before buying passes:
- Redeem every working code on Codes — UPDATE3.75-style patches often grant 200 Gems plus rerolls.
- Finish NPC quests in each world described in Getting Started.
- Clear Trials when ready for bonus Gem drops.
- Progress Battle Pass levels during active seasons noted in Updates.
- Join Discord at discord.com/invite/animeduelists for flash codes between patches.
Bank those Gems until you know your purchase order. Impulse buys on Luck potions delay Multi Open by days of farming.
S-tier Game Passes — buy these first
Multi Open
Multi Open is the highest-value pass in Anime Duelists. It hatches multiple Stars per action, multiplying Mythical and Secret odds during Auto Hatch sessions. If you buy only one pass, make it this one.
Impact:
- Faster Mythical and Secret Units hunts
- Better use of Luck boosts from codes
- Compounds with Fast Open for marathon farms
Extra Equip
Extra Equip adds fighter slots in battle worlds. More equipped units means higher DPS, quicker quest clears, and smoother Trials attempts. Buy second unless you already own a Mythical and need damage more than hatch volume.
Fast Open
Fast Open increases hatch animation speed. Alone it is quality of life; paired with Multi Open it becomes a production engine for overnight Roblox sessions. Third in the recommended order on the Game Passes tier list.
A-tier — strong after the big three
| Pass | Role |
|---|---|
| 2x Money | Permanent currency multiplier for upgrades |
| 1.5x Experience | Faster fighter leveling in new worlds |
| Shiny Chance | Long-term collectible odds |
Buy these after S-tier passes unless a sale event bundles them cheaply during Updates seasons.
B-tier and below — luxury picks
Luck and Super Luck help odds but lose to raw volume from Multi Open. VIP discounts Stars over time — nice, not urgent. Ultra Luck often costs more than buying Luck plus Super Luck separately. Storage only expands inventory; achievements already grant space. Potion Bundles expire — skip until permanent passes are owned.

Recommended purchase order
- Multi Open
- Extra Equip
- Fast Open
- 2x Money
- 1.5x Experience
- Shiny Chance
- Luck
- Super Luck
- VIP
- Storage and potion bundles last
Free players should still follow the order — just save longer between buys.
Gems versus Robux bundles
Robux Starter Packs and accessory bundles sell convenience, not permanent hatch multipliers. If you have limited Robux, convert mindset to Gems via codes first, then buy Multi Open. Accessory bundles can wait until S-tier passes are done.
Never trade real money for sketchy Gem generators advertised on Scripts sites — those are scams or ban bait.
How Game Passes interact with systems
Auto Hatch: Multi Open plus Fast Open defines AFK efficiency in Getting Started.
Rerolls: Codes grant rerolls; Gems should not replace reroll bundles unless a shop sale explicitly beats code value. Save rerolls for Mythicals per Traits and Stats.
Trading: Duplicate Mythicals from extra hatch volume become trade assets in Trading. Multi Open indirectly fuels that economy.
Trials: Extra Equip power spikes Trial clears; under-buying passes forces over-grinding.
Spending mistakes to avoid
- Buying Ultra Luck before Multi Open.
- Converting Gems to single-use potions during a normal farm day.
- Purchasing Storage while still overflowing with disposable Rares.
- Ignoring Codes then complaining Gems are pay-only.
- Skipping Updates patch notes and rebuying nerfed bundles.
Seasonal and patch strategy
Major updates like 3.75 often add limited shop SKUs. Compare any new pass against the eternal trio before buying. If Toonrise Studios releases a Gem rebate event, stack it with code income and delay non-S-tier buys.
Cross-check fighter value on Players so Extra Equip slots hold Mythicals worth the investment.

What is the best Game Pass in Anime Duelists?
Multi Open is the best first purchase. It hatches multiple Stars at once and dramatically speeds Mythical farming. Fast Open and Extra Equip follow.
How do I get free Gems in Anime Duelists?
Redeem Codes page promos, finish world quests, clear Trials, and progress the Battle Pass. UPDATE-style codes are the fastest bulk source.
Should I buy Luck before Multi Open?
No. Multi Open increases total rolls, which beats small luck bonuses. Follow the Game Passes tier list order.
Are potion bundles worth Gems?
Usually not early. Permanent passes multiply every session; potions expire. Buy potions only after owning Multi Open, Extra Equip, and Fast Open.
Where do I spend Gems in Anime Duelists?
Open the Shop menu on the left HUD. Game Passes are permanent tabs; code redemption sits in the same Shop window at the bottom.
